Transaction 672108d836ddd58ef227ce295e3a1ca2874988c12bcf38b5ddc16396c19b5cea
1 Input
1 Output
-
672108d836ddd58ef227ce295e3a1ca2874988c12bcf38b5ddc16396c19b5cea:0
- value
- 499951699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d07a1d284aeafbdaade3d155910df2b4fe95ba3 OP_EQUAL
- address
- 35o7UTvZGK9WQvDPEtc6gs3mSmCPFT57RU